description Haraiya Overview
Haraiya is a howardite meteorite that fell in the state of Uttar Pradesh, India. Howardites are a group of achondritic meteorites formed from the surface regolith of asteroid 4 Vesta. Haraiya is characterized as a polymict breccia, meaning it is composed of mixed fragments of both eucrite and diogenite rocks that were lithified together. This composition provides scientists with a comprehensive sample of the diverse crustal lithologies present on Vesta, offering valuable data for understanding the volcanic and impact history of large differentiated asteroids.

Why is Haraiya classified as a howardite rather than an ordinary chondrite?
Haraiya is an achondritic breccia made from mixed fragments of differentiated asteroid material, not a chondrite containing primitive chondrules. Howardites are associated with the surface of asteroid 4 Vesta.
What does polymict breccia mean in the case of Haraiya?
Polymict means that Haraiya contains many different rock fragments cemented together in one meteorite. That mixture reflects regolith material repeatedly broken up and redeposited on 4 Vesta's surface.
How does Haraiya relate to eucrites and diogenites?
Howardites such as Haraiya commonly contain fragments related to both eucrites and diogenites. Together, these meteorites form the HED group, which is linked to 4 Vesta.
Where did Haraiya fall?
Haraiya fell in the Indian state of Uttar Pradesh. Its observed fall location is important because it distinguishes the meteorite from many finds recovered later from deserts.
